    We all liked the dish. At first, I avoided it becasue it looked like a lot of work. It really wasn't.

    The meatballs were easy. Be sure to mash the tofu up really well. Really kill it. I had chunks of tofu in the meatballs, which I didn't like. I also made the balls a lot smaller- walnut sized. They were easier to eat, and cooked faster.

    We liked the veggie mix, except that we all agreed that less carrot and more cabbage would suit us better. We also agreed that the strong flavors would stand up to the addition of bamboo shoots and water chestnuts.

    All in all, excellent. I will certainly make it again!
